Output 5a40a8e181bbdfb87b8575b4d7d95b0e0a135d855c3868b3d9f7752a5718b68c:1

value
622913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4ef05b21ddd57b15245cab6d9f17dd6aeabc1f OP_EQUAL
address
3HfxjtFCeTUvzbfBDAea8uT31jiTmPtQwg
transaction
5a40a8e181bbdfb87b8575b4d7d95b0e0a135d855c3868b3d9f7752a5718b68c
spent
true